Output 746efe6a35631b5d29cbd4fb696238fa3b8081fea4fbdf3cb0e7a85d1ca632e6:9

value
17597
script pubkey
OP_0 OP_PUSHBYTES_20 3c2c947704aafbc7abc1b71a1e684427ba049abb
address
bc1q8skfgacy4tau027pkudpu6zyy7aqfx4mmmnpee
transaction
746efe6a35631b5d29cbd4fb696238fa3b8081fea4fbdf3cb0e7a85d1ca632e6